Output 89abc72a4b218e3b3dbb441d15b454d8958f72530a1553666e4062095e6a9652:4

value
20800911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18897abec2eefaecfdc9aca54d36d26cf0d22631 OP_EQUAL
address
33vkqPWgUYdwJMgbV9dPLUpaXKHJTFCx9K
transaction
89abc72a4b218e3b3dbb441d15b454d8958f72530a1553666e4062095e6a9652
confirmations
281673
spent
true